Recordation Costs Sample Clauses

Recordation Costs. The Buyer shall pay all state and county recordation taxes, documentary stamp taxes and transfer taxes, including all agricultural land transfer taxes. The Buyer shall pay any recording fees, lien certificate charges, survey costs, title examination fees, title insurance premiums, and all other costs incurred in recording the deed among the Land Records of Xxxxxxx County, Maryland. The Seller hereby notifies the Buyer that the conveyance of the Property to the Buyer may be subject to the agricultural land transfer tax imposed under subtitle 3, title 13 of the Maryland Tax-Property Code.

Recordation Costs. The expenses associated with recordation of the licenses granted under this Agreement whether by way of the filing of this document or through the use of a separate recordable instrument shall be borne by Distributor. Distributor shall furnish to Supplier within ten days of their filing a written copy of all such filings recorded.
Recordation Costs. Seller shall pay the cost of any recording fee and any state or county recordation tax or other transfer fee incurred in recording the deed or any related documents among the real property records of the applicable counties in which the Facilities reside. Buyer shall pay for (i) one-half the costs of any title insurance, (ii) the costs of real property surveys and other inspections or tests with respect to the Facilities, (iii) its own legal fees, and (iv) the amount of net adjustments (as described below), if any, to be paid to Seller. Seller shall pay (i) one-half the costs of title insurance, (ii) any amounts expressly assumed in this Agreement, (iii) its own legal fees and (iv) the amount of net adjustments (as described below), if any, to be paid to Buyer.
Recordation Costs. Seller and Buyer shall each pay one-half (1/2) of the cost of any recording fee and any state or local recordation tax, documentary stamp tax or other transfer tax or fee incurred in recording the said deed. Any agricultural transfer tax shall be the responsibility of Seller.
Recordation Costs. Buyer shall be responsible for the cost of recording the Deed.
